Petitioner Margarito Velasquez-Rodriguez, a native and citizen of

Honduras, petitions for review from the denial of his applications for

withholding of removal and relief under the Convention Against Torture (CAT).

An immigration judge (IJ) denied petitioner’s applications, and the Board of
